A long roll packed with thin-sliced beef and melted cheese, often with fried onions. It is Philadelphia's signature street and comfort food.
A soft pretzel with a distinct figure-eight twist and chewy texture. Sold by street vendors and bakeries, it is a classic Philadelphia snack.
A roast pork sandwich with garlicky pork, sharp provolone, and broccoli rabe. Many locals consider it the city's best traditional sandwich.

Moderate for a major US city. Hotels can be pricey in Center City, but dining and transit are often cheaper than New York or Washington.
Tip 18-20% in restaurants, 15-20% for taxis, and $1-2 per drink or cafe order if service is provided.
